When an On-Site Sewage Facility (OSSF) is neglected in the Pahokee area, the localized consequences are distinct and hazardous:
- Lake Okeechobee Eutrophication: Pahokee is ground zero for massive environmental restoration efforts. A failing septic system releases high nitrogen and phosphorus loads directly into the groundwater and agricultural canals feeding the lake. This nutrient runoff fuels massive, toxic blue-green algae blooms in Lake Okeechobee.
- The “Muck” Hydraulic Lock: The dark, organic muck soil of Pahokee does not percolate like coastal sand. During Florida’s intense summer thunderstorms, this soil saturates and holds water. If a septic tank is full of sludge, the effluent cannot exit into the saturated muck, causing raw sewage to instantly back up into homes or farmhouses.
- Agricultural Runoff & Compaction: On sprawling sugarcane farms and agricultural acreage, an overloaded system can cause raw sewage to pool on the surface. Furthermore, heavy tractors or agricultural equipment driving over unmarked drain fields instantly crush the PVC pipes in the soft, shifting muck.
- System Settling: Heavy concrete tanks installed in deep muck are prone to shifting and settling unevenly over the decades, shearing off PVC inlet lines and causing massive subterranean leaks.

Local Permitting Authority
For Pahokee, Florida, which is located in Palm Beach County, the local permitting and regulatory authority for Onsite Sewage Treatment and Disposal Systems (OSTDS), commonly known as septic systems, is the Florida Department of Health in Palm Beach County.
- All permit applications, site evaluations, system design approvals, and inspections for new installations, repairs, or modifications of septic systems in Pahokee must be processed through this specific health department office.
Specific Septic Tank Regulations (Florida Administrative Code)
The regulations governing OSTDS in Pahokee and throughout Florida are primarily set forth in the Florida Administrative Code (F.A.C.). The most critical chapter is:
- Chapter 64E-6, Florida Administrative Code (F.A.C.) β Standards for Onsite Sewage Treatment and Disposal Systems.
This chapter dictates all aspects of septic system design, installation, repair, and maintenance. Key regulatory points relevant to Pahokee often include:
- Minimum Setbacks: Strict separation distances from wells, property lines, water bodies, and other structures are mandated (e.g., 75 feet from private potable wells, 100 feet from public potable wells, 50 feet from surface waters).
- Soil Suitability and Water Table Separation: This is particularly crucial for Pahokee. The regulations require specific vertical separation between the bottom of the drain field (absorption surface) and the estimated wet season high water table (WSHWT). Generally, a minimum of 24 inches (2 feet) of suitable unsaturated soil is required below the drain field. This often necessitates specialized designs in Pahokee due to local soil and water table conditions.
- System Sizing: Sizing of the septic tank and drain field is determined by the number of bedrooms in the residence and other factors, as outlined in tables within Chapter 64E-6 F.A.C.
- Permitting Process: Requires a site evaluation, system design by a licensed professional (or approved plans from the manufacturer for certain proprietary systems), permit application, and inspections during construction.
- Maintenance: Regular maintenance, including septic tank pumping, is encouraged and often required for certain advanced treatment systems.
Typical Soil Drainage Characteristics in Pahokee
Pahokee is situated on the eastern shore of Lake Okeechobee, within the Everglades Agricultural Area (EAA). This region is characterized by very specific and challenging soil conditions for conventional septic systems:
- Soil Type: The predominant soil types are highly organic soils, primarily Histosols, often referred to as "Everglades Muck" or "organic muck soils." These soils are formed from decomposed plant material.
- Drainage Characteristics:
- Poor Permeability: While organic soils can absorb a lot of water, their hydraulic conductivity (how quickly water moves through them) can be highly variable and often poor, especially when saturated or compacted.
- High Water Table: Pahokee experiences a naturally very high seasonal water table, often at or near the surface, particularly during the wet season (typically June through October). This is a critical limiting factor for septic drain field design.
- Low Bearing Capacity: Organic muck soils can have low bearing capacity, which can impact the stability of elevated systems if not properly designed.
- Impact on Drain Field Design: Due to the high water table and often poor drainage characteristics of muck soils, conventional in-ground drain fields are rarely feasible in Pahokee. This dictates the necessity for specialized designs to achieve the required 24-inch separation from the WSHWT:
- Elevated Drain Fields / Mound Systems: These are the most common solutions. They involve importing suitable fill material (e.g., sand or sandy loam) to create an elevated mound above the natural grade. The drain field is constructed within this imported material, ensuring adequate separation from the underlying high water table.
- Performance-Based Treatment Systems (PBTS): In some cases, advanced secondary treatment systems may be required to further reduce effluent contaminants before discharge, especially if site constraints are severe. These systems often feature aerobic treatment units (ATUs).
Realistic 2026 Cost Estimates for Pahokee (Palm Beach County)
Please note that these are estimates for 2026 and actual costs can vary based on specific site conditions, chosen contractor, and system complexity.
- Septic Tank Pumping (1,000-1,500 Gallon Tank):
- For routine pumping and cleaning in the Pahokee market, you can expect to pay anywhere from $400 to $750. Factors influencing the cost include tank size, accessibility, and the presence of any blockages or issues.
- New Septic System Installation (Residential, Standard for Pahokee Conditions):
- Given the challenging soil and high water table conditions in Pahokee, a standard conventional system is unlikely. Instead, an elevated drain field or mound system, which requires importing significant amounts of fill material and more complex design, will be necessary.
- For a typical 3-4 bedroom residence, a new elevated septic system installation in Pahokee could realistically range from $12,000 to $35,000+.
- Factors that will heavily influence the cost include:
- The amount of fill material needed for elevation.
- The type of advanced treatment system (if required, e.g., ATU).
- Site accessibility for heavy equipment.
- The specific design approved by the Florida Department of Health in Palm Beach County.
- Permit fees and engineering design costs.
- Costs could exceed this range for very challenging sites requiring extensive site preparation or highly advanced treatment technologies.
